Y/A is yards per attempt, but I think I was looking at adjusted yards/attempt rather than air yards per attempt. So I did some more research, here are the actual AY/A numbers for Peyton from 2012-2015 2012 - 4th in the NFL in raw # of air yards, 4.57 AY/A, 57.2% of his total yards were air yards, his per attempt #s were behind only Eli (#shocked) and Wilson. 2013 - 1st in the NFL in raw # of air yards, 4.24 AY/A, 51% of his total yards were air yards, his per attempt #s were behind only Foles, Kaepernick, Wilson and Cutler 2014 - 2nd in NFL in raw # of air yards, 4.54 AY/A, 57.4% of his total yards were air yards, his per attempt #s were behind only Tony Romo among full-time starters 2015 - 27th in NFL in raw # of air yards, 3.85 AY/A, 56.7% of his total yards were air yards, his per attempt #s were behind Matt Schaub and Brandon Weeden as well as 15 QBs who threw for at least 2,000 yards. Since most full-time QBs in those years hovered between 4 and 4.5 AY/A, that is a one year drop from being top tier in AY/A to being unstartable. For the record, here are his numbers in 2010, his last healthy season in Indy. 2010 - 1st in the NFL in raw # of air yards, 3.97 AY/A (worse than any of his first three Denver seasons), 57.4% of his total yards were air yards, his per attempt #s were behind 11 other QBs who threw for at least 2,000 yards. 2009 - I won't do a full one here, but his AY/A was 4.22, worse than any Denver year except 2015. In short, Peyton's arm was starting to slip by the time he got to Denver, but it was still perfectly fine and combined with his smarts produced a very good downfield passing game in 2012-2014.
